What Are the Signs That Your Home’s Air Ducts Need to Be Sealed or Repaired?
Leaky ducts in attics, unfinished basements, crawl spaces, and garages can allow dirt, dust, moisture, pollen, pests, and fumes to enter your living spaces. Watch for these common warning signs that indicate your system needs professional attention:[4]
- Excessive Dust and Allergy Flare-Ups: Leaky return ducts pull in outdoor allergens, fine dust, and attic insulation. If you notice a constant film of dust on furniture shortly after cleaning, your system is likely drawing in dirty air.
- Uneven Temperatures and Weak Airflow: When supply ducts or flexible runs tear, conditioned air escapes into your attic instead of reaching your rooms. This air loss leaves rooms drafty, hot, or stagnant.
- Spiking Utility Bills: If your energy bills rise without a change in usage, your system is running longer to compensate for leaks.

Air Duct Cleaning vs. Duct Sealing: What is the Difference?
It is common to confuse these two services, but they serve entirely different purposes:
- Air Duct Cleaning: This process removes accumulated dirt, dust, pet dander, and allergens from inside your ductwork. While air duct cleaning Woodland Hills services improve immediate air purity, Premier Air Duct Solutions Woodland Hills notes that cleaning alone does not fix structural leaks.
- Duct Sealing: This process physically closes the cracks, gaps, and disconnected joints in your ductwork. It stops conditioned air from escaping and prevents dirty attic air from entering the system.
For the best results, we often recommend performing both services. Cleaning removes the existing debris, while professional HVAC duct sealing Woodland Hills services ensure that new dust and pollutants cannot slip back into your clean system.

How do I verify that my newly sealed ducts comply with California Title 24 energy standards?
Compliance is verified through a professional duct leakage test, which measures system pressure to ensure air loss is under the strict state-mandated threshold.
